Maharashtra to lease fallow land to SHGs, give Rs1 lakh grant per group

Mumbai, June 16 (UNI) In a major boost to rural livelihoods and women's empowerment, the Maharashtra government has announced an ambitious scheme to lease fallow government land to women’s Self-Help Groups (SHGs).
Revenue Minister Chandrashekhar Bawankule announced that under this new policy, eligible women’s SHGs will be allotted one hectare (approximately 2.5 acres) of vacant revenue department land on a five-year lease. Additionally, each SHG will receive a financial grant of Rs 1 lakh to initiate productive activities.
The primary goal of the initiative is to ensure the productive use of barren and encroached government land while simultaneously creating sustainable employment for rural women. SHGs can utilize this land for fodder cultivation, bamboo plantation, Napier grass farming, or grassland development.
